Connecting a 23 inch monitor to comcast HD cable box

Hi folks
I just got a 23 inch monitor and I am interested to know if anyone has used the display to output video from a cable box. I have a female DVI to HDMI connector and the cable box has an HDMI port. Is there anything else I should worry about?
thanks!
12 inch powerbook   Mac OS X (10.4.8)   23 inch apple display

I have not tried this myself with my 20" cinema display but when I tried it with a viewsonic monitor I had problems with the Digital Copy Protection system they use on the HDMI/DVI ports on the cable boxes to prevent people from copying the video. I do not know if the Apple display has HDCP support or not. If it does it should work fine, otherwise your get an error message on the screen telling you there is a DCP error. Either way if you already have the cables give it a try it won't hurt your monitot. Note that if you get a DCP error (or no display) when you connect the HDMI cable restart the cable box with the monitor attached to see if that works.

  • Connecting Macbook via mini-dvi to vga (s-video) to Dell 24 inch monitor

    I'm connected but, the screen does not look good at all. I can barely read the text.
    I tried connecting via the rca cable and the s-video cable - but both are blurry. I checked the settings, but the maximum setting doesn't even go to 1920x.... at all.
    Another option on the monitor is a DVI cable. Do I need a mini-DVI to DVI adapter instead? Or is there a setting somehow to make the s-video connection much better.
    My monitor is a Dell 2405FPW.

    Tele is right. If you are mirroring the same image on both displays, you will never get more resolution than the lower resolution display.
    If you instead create an extended desktop where you can view different content on both your MacBook screen and the external monitor, then you CAN set different resolutions for both screens. The MacBook's internal LCD is only 1280x800, but the MacBook can do 1920x1200 resolution on an external monitor per the specs here: http://www.apple.com/macbook/specs.html
    If you're doing this right, the display should be sharp and crisp. But you definitely want to be using a DVI or VGA cable, and NOT s-video or RCA/composite. Do you have a mini-DVI to DVI cable? Here it is: http://store.apple.com/1-800-MY-APPLE/WebObjects/AppleStore?productLearnMore=M93 21G/B
    DVI is sharper than VGA is sharper than S-video is sharper than RCA/composite.

  • Does i Mac monitor support HDTV or cable TV connections?

    I thinking of purchasing a i Mac system with a 27 inch monitor. I need to know if this monitor will support  a HDTV or HDMI connection from any source especially Direct TV?

    ezbentrider wrote:
    I thinking of purchasing a i Mac system with a 27 inch monitor. I need to know if this monitor will support  a HDTV or HDMI connection from any source especially Direct TV?
    I am generalizing what I think you want and I will have to say no it cannot.  Assuming Direct TV is a slave to the entertainment industry like apple is then HDCP copy protection will not allow you to connect your DTV to your computer for HD reception. 
    If the DTV box has component, composite, or s-video out then those can be used.  But of course that isn't HD.
    The Elgato products allow you to pass those connections into your computer.  They also allow you to attach an antenna for over the air reception and that will be HD from those channels that broadcast HD.  I also think Elgato has their own HD service but I am not sure of that.
